fre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

無紙化考試系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)畢業(yè)論文-文庫吧資料

2025-06-28 21:16本頁面
  

【正文】 FMT_LEFT,width/5,1)。 this(2,_T(命題教師),LVCFMT_LEFT,width/5,1)。 this(0,_T(試卷編號(hào)),LVCFMT_LEFT,width/5,1)。 int width = ()+2。 this(amp。再看他的初始化函數(shù):BOOL CstartexamDlg::OnInitDialog(){ CDialog::OnInitDialog()。 void displayItem()。public: int OnClose(CString ip)。 bool checkclientmap()。//name and ippublic: void AddToMap(CString name,CString ip)。//存儲(chǔ)套接字對(duì)象,方便釋放內(nèi)存 mapCString,CMysocket*socketmap。public: void OnAccept(void)。public: CCExamServerDlg* parent_pointer。//指向和客戶連接的套接字指針數(shù)組 CMysocket* m_sever_socket。public: CListCtrl m_paperListCtrl。public:private: void Listen()。protected: virtual void DoDataExchange(CDataExchange* pDX)。 // 標(biāo)準(zhǔn)構(gòu)造函數(shù) virtual ~CstartexamDlg()。在線考試在窗體初始化時(shí)開啟了一個(gè)偵聽套接字,等待客戶端的連接。對(duì)于四種型題內(nèi)部采用了四個(gè)窗體顯示,在題型變換的過程中顯示某個(gè)窗體和隱藏其他窗體,由于這四個(gè)窗體是作為子窗體,整體外觀看起來非常的一致。答題完畢后,自動(dòng)保存到當(dāng)前目錄下ans_paper目錄下,若網(wǎng)絡(luò)狀態(tài)良好,立即發(fā)送至服務(wù)器端。 return TRUE。 thisGetDlgItem(IDC_STATIC_SUBJECTWARN)SetWindowText(_T())。 this(1)。 i4。 //主觀題 CString sz3[4]={_T(3),_T(4),_T(5),_T(6)}。 thism_judge_value = 1。 i++) this(i,sz2[i])。 //判斷題 for(int i=0。 thism_fillblank_value = 2。 i++) this(i,sz2[i])。 //填空 for(int i=0。 thism_multi_value = 2。 i++) this(i,sz2[i])。 for(int i=0。 thism_single = FALSE。 this(2)。 i6。 // TODO: 在此添加額外的初始化 //單選 CString sz[6]={_T(5),_T(8),_T(10),_T(12),_T(15),_T(16)}。文件頭結(jié)構(gòu)將對(duì)整個(gè)文件的結(jié)構(gòu)做描述,使得對(duì)數(shù)據(jù)的讀取和寫入有序。//主觀題指針,將指向數(shù)組public: afx_msg void OnClose()。//填空題指針,將指向數(shù)組 CSjudge_subject2* m_pjudge_subject。//文件頭指針 CSselect_subject2* m_pselect_subject。 void Cleardata(void)。 virtual ~CWizardSheet()。父窗口類聲明:class CWizardSheet : public CPropertySheet{ DECLARE_DYNAMIC(CWizardSheet)public: CWizardSheet(UINT nIDCaption, CWnd* pParentWnd = NULL, UINT iSelectPage = 0)。流程圖如圖7所示:圖7 試卷生成流程圖題型及數(shù)目確定了,程序內(nèi)部的指針指向的空間大小也就確定了,題目填充后的數(shù)據(jù)將被指針?biāo)赶虻膬?nèi)存中,在保存點(diǎn)擊后,所有數(shù)據(jù)存入文件。(2)具體的題目?jī)?nèi)容,可修改默認(rèn)的分值。程序流程圖如6所示圖6 題庫管理流程圖初始化:在數(shù)據(jù)庫中搜索所有試卷及由當(dāng)前用戶命題的試卷,存儲(chǔ)為鏈表。 (3)在線考試登錄系統(tǒng)→選擇開始考試,等客戶端的連接→所有考生從客戶端登錄→服務(wù)器端發(fā)送試卷確認(rèn)所有學(xué)生收到試卷→點(diǎn)擊開始,所有客戶端開始記時(shí)→考試結(jié)束,客戶端自動(dòng)交卷 (4)成績(jī)查詢登錄系統(tǒng)→選擇成績(jī)查詢→選擇查詢方式輸入關(guān)鍵→顯示查詢結(jié)果(5)用戶管理root登錄系統(tǒng)→選擇用戶管理→當(dāng)需要增加用戶時(shí)輸入注冊(cè)所需的信息,點(diǎn)擊注冊(cè)→當(dāng)需要注銷用戶時(shí),輸入必須信息,點(diǎn)擊注冊(cè)(6)閱卷系統(tǒng)登錄系統(tǒng)→系統(tǒng)初始化,讀取需要批改的答卷顯示在列表中→選擇要批改的答卷,自動(dòng)對(duì)客觀題評(píng)分,輔助進(jìn)行主觀題評(píng)分→閱卷完畢,將數(shù)據(jù)信息存入數(shù)據(jù)庫 客戶端說明學(xué)生以合法身份從客戶端登陸,連接服務(wù)器后等待老師在客戶端發(fā)放試卷,然后進(jìn)行答題??荚囅到y(tǒng)服務(wù)器客戶端考卷管理試卷向?qū)в脩艄芾砜荚囅到y(tǒng)閱卷系統(tǒng)答卷系統(tǒng)圖5系統(tǒng)總體結(jié)構(gòu)圖(1)登錄系統(tǒng)初始化→顯示登錄對(duì)話框→點(diǎn)擊登錄,查詢數(shù)據(jù)庫進(jìn)行密碼匹配,若成功根據(jù)權(quán)限顯示主界面,失敗則顯示還有兩次重試機(jī)會(huì)。 考試系統(tǒng)的數(shù)據(jù)表序號(hào)表名說明1stu_info學(xué)生信息表2dept_info學(xué)院信息表3majorno專業(yè)信息表4teacher_info教師信息表5papers_info試卷信息表6stu_score_detail學(xué)生成績(jī)?cè)斍楸?class_info班級(jí)信息表系統(tǒng)中幾個(gè)重要的表的結(jié)構(gòu)如下:字段類型說明teacher_novarchar(20)教師號(hào)teacher_namevarchar(20)教師姓名sexbit性別agetinyint年齡passwordvarchar(20)密碼contact_infovarchar(50)聯(lián)系方式字段類型說明paper_novarchar(20)試卷編號(hào)subjectvarchar(20)科目create_dateDatetime創(chuàng)建日期creator_novarcher(20)命題人編號(hào)usedtimesInt使用次數(shù) 學(xué)生成績(jī)?cè)斍楸韘tu_score_detail字段類型說明stu_novarchar(20)學(xué)號(hào)paper_novarchar(20)試卷編號(hào)select_scoreInt選擇題分?jǐn)?shù)fillblank_scoreInt填空題分?jǐn)?shù)judge_scoreInt判斷題分?jǐn)?shù)subjective_scoreInt主觀題分?jǐn)?shù)all_scoreInt總分注冊(cè)數(shù)據(jù)源,使用控制面板-管理工具-數(shù)據(jù)源ODBC,利用向?qū)韯?chuàng)建。 47教師信息表姓名性別年齡教師號(hào)聯(lián)系方式學(xué)生信息表姓名年齡性別學(xué)號(hào)班級(jí)編號(hào)專業(yè)編號(hào)學(xué)院編號(hào)圖4(a) 圖4(b)試卷信息表創(chuàng)建日期試卷編號(hào)使用次數(shù)命題人科目成績(jī)信息表選擇題分試卷編號(hào)填空題分?jǐn)?shù)判斷題分?jǐn)?shù)學(xué)號(hào)創(chuàng)建日期圖4(c) 圖4(d)學(xué)院信息表專業(yè)信息表班級(jí)信息表學(xué)院編號(hào)學(xué)院名稱專業(yè)編號(hào)專業(yè)名稱班級(jí)編號(hào)班級(jí)名稱編號(hào) 圖4(e)學(xué)院試卷信息學(xué)生班級(jí)教師專業(yè)成績(jī)R11R21nR2R3R41nn1n11圖4(f)圖4 各實(shí)體關(guān)系圖數(shù)據(jù)庫的邏輯結(jié)構(gòu)設(shè)計(jì)是將數(shù)據(jù)的概念結(jié)構(gòu)轉(zhuǎn)化為SQL Server2000數(shù)據(jù)庫系統(tǒng)的實(shí)際模型,得到數(shù)據(jù)庫的邏輯結(jié)構(gòu)后,就可以在SQLServer2000數(shù)據(jù)庫系統(tǒng)中建立表結(jié)構(gòu)。根據(jù)系統(tǒng)功能,所需要的實(shí)體主要有:教師、考試題目、學(xué)生。這樣,既隔開了每個(gè)客戶組織的數(shù)據(jù),同時(shí)又使服務(wù)組織只需管理一臺(tái)服務(wù)器計(jì)算機(jī)從而減少了費(fèi)用。例如。超大型Internet站點(diǎn)可將其數(shù)據(jù)分開存放在多臺(tái)服務(wù)器上,從而使處理負(fù)荷分散到多臺(tái)計(jì)算機(jī)上,使站點(diǎn)能為成千上萬的并發(fā)用戶提供服務(wù)。SQLServer2000為這些環(huán)境提供了全面的保護(hù),具有防止問題發(fā)生的安全措施,例如,可以防止多個(gè)用戶試圖同時(shí)更新相同的數(shù)據(jù)。Microsoft SQL Server2000能提供超大型系統(tǒng)所需的數(shù)據(jù)庫服務(wù)。復(fù)制同樣使得可以維護(hù)多個(gè)數(shù)據(jù)復(fù)本,同時(shí)確保單獨(dú)的數(shù)據(jù)復(fù)本保持同步。數(shù)據(jù)庫引擎充分保護(hù)數(shù)據(jù)完整性,同時(shí)將管理上千個(gè)并發(fā)使用修改數(shù)據(jù)庫的用戶的開銷減到最小。本系統(tǒng)采用Microsoft SQL Server2000數(shù)據(jù)庫。僅用于客戶端。在本系統(tǒng)中,有三種用戶存在,管理員、教師和考生,三種用戶擁有不同的權(quán)限,權(quán)利分開,互不干涉。(1)選擇答卷,自動(dòng)批改客觀題。該子系統(tǒng)實(shí)現(xiàn)用戶的總體管理,主要包括:(1)教師信息管理:教師的增加,刪除,修改。該子系統(tǒng)實(shí)現(xiàn)考生的網(wǎng)上考試過程,主要包括:(1)考生登錄:該子系統(tǒng)接受考生輸入的個(gè)人身份信息,進(jìn)行驗(yàn)證,允許合法考生進(jìn)入考試系統(tǒng),進(jìn)行考試;(2)計(jì)時(shí)答卷:服務(wù)器發(fā)送開始指令后,客戶端系統(tǒng)計(jì)時(shí)開始,考生進(jìn)行答卷;(3)試卷提交:包括考生在規(guī)定時(shí)間內(nèi)主動(dòng)提交試卷和考試時(shí)間己到,系統(tǒng)強(qiáng)迫提交試卷。該子系統(tǒng)是對(duì)試題庫資源進(jìn)行維護(hù)、管理和修改的應(yīng)用平臺(tái),它主要包括:(1)以列表的形式簡(jiǎn)要地顯示所有試卷信息;(2)修改試卷,包括對(duì)每個(gè)題目?jī)?nèi)容答案和分值等的修改;(3)使用他人創(chuàng)建的試卷??荚囅到y(tǒng)服務(wù)器數(shù)據(jù)庫服務(wù)器客戶端1客戶端2客戶端3客戶端4圖1系統(tǒng)體系結(jié)構(gòu)圖客戶只與服務(wù)器進(jìn)行網(wǎng)絡(luò)通信,而服務(wù)既與客戶端通信又與數(shù)據(jù)庫進(jìn)行訪問。服務(wù)器由應(yīng)用程序服務(wù)器和數(shù)據(jù)庫服務(wù)器組成,應(yīng)用程序服務(wù)器與數(shù)據(jù)庫進(jìn)行交互。為一個(gè)Web服務(wù)器書寫的HTML文檔,可以被所有平臺(tái)上的瀏覽器打開,實(shí)現(xiàn)了應(yīng)用軟件的跨平臺(tái)操作,而且不需修改任何程序,缺點(diǎn)在于完全依賴網(wǎng)絡(luò),沒有網(wǎng)絡(luò)就無法工作,無法對(duì)考試時(shí)行實(shí)時(shí)監(jiān)控,可控性差,使用也很顯然容易造成試題泄漏,對(duì)重要考試顯然是不可取的。服務(wù)器上所有的應(yīng)用程序均可通過web瀏覽器在客戶機(jī)上執(zhí)行,可以充分發(fā)揮開發(fā)人員的群體優(yōu)勢(shì),應(yīng)用軟件的維護(hù)也相對(duì)簡(jiǎn)單。用B/S方式時(shí),集中開發(fā)人員在服務(wù)器端進(jìn)行開發(fā)、調(diào)試、維護(hù),開發(fā)人員只需要面對(duì)服務(wù)器端的應(yīng)用程序,無需開發(fā)客戶端程序,減少了工作量。界面統(tǒng)一,易用,不用培訓(xùn)。充分利用現(xiàn)有的瀏覽器軟件,無需開發(fā)數(shù)據(jù)庫前端。(3)瀏覽器/服務(wù)器(B/S)體系結(jié)構(gòu)在此種模式中,客戶端的標(biāo)準(zhǔn)配置是瀏覽器,如IE、Netscape等;Web服務(wù)器成為應(yīng)用處理的標(biāo)準(zhǔn)配置,數(shù)據(jù)處理仍然由數(shù)據(jù)庫服務(wù)器(DB Serve)完成。為了適應(yīng)一些大型的結(jié)構(gòu)復(fù)雜的系統(tǒng)應(yīng)用,出現(xiàn)了三層結(jié)構(gòu)的C/S結(jié)構(gòu)模式,它把兩層結(jié)構(gòu)中服務(wù)器部分和客戶端部分的應(yīng)用單獨(dú)劃出來,從而滿足大型應(yīng)用系統(tǒng)的要求。(2)客戶機(jī)/服務(wù)器(C/S)體系結(jié)構(gòu)這種結(jié)構(gòu)的出現(xiàn)最初是為了緩解前種模式中主機(jī)繁重的工作負(fù)擔(dān),將原來功能很強(qiáng)大的主機(jī)退化成數(shù)據(jù)庫服務(wù)器,同時(shí)轉(zhuǎn)移原來主機(jī)的一部分工作到客戶機(jī)上,顯然這就增加了客戶機(jī)的要求。這種模式中,服務(wù)器存儲(chǔ)所有數(shù)據(jù)。 4 系統(tǒng)設(shè)計(jì)方案(1)終端/主機(jī)體系結(jié)構(gòu)這是一種早期處理數(shù)據(jù)采用的模式,這種結(jié)構(gòu)使得終端用戶盡可能地共享資源,終端所需做的是輸入命令,顯示結(jié)果。該版本繼承了SQL Server 版本的優(yōu)點(diǎn),同時(shí)又比它增加了許多更先進(jìn)的功能,具有使用方便、可伸縮性好、與相關(guān)軟件集成程度高等優(yōu)點(diǎn)。Sybase 則較專注于SQL Server在UNIX 操作系統(tǒng)上的應(yīng)用。在Windows NT 推出后,Microsoft與Sybase 在SQL Server 的開發(fā)上就分道揚(yáng)鑣了。SQL Server 是一個(gè)關(guān)系數(shù)據(jù)庫管理系統(tǒng)。+SQLserver 2000。最少的服務(wù)+最小的權(quán)限=最大的安全的原則,注意NTFS權(quán)限的設(shè)置,及時(shí)為系統(tǒng)管理員帳號(hào)更名,嚴(yán)格限制服務(wù),關(guān)閉不必要的端口,最好能配置安全審核策略。系統(tǒng)要從安裝、配置和管理三個(gè)方面入手,對(duì)Windows2000 Server進(jìn)行安全設(shè)計(jì):(1)安裝:在安裝安全方面注意采用NTFS文件分區(qū)格式以及安裝微軟官方公布的最新Server Packs和補(bǔ)丁。本系統(tǒng)選用微軟的Microsoft Windows2000 Server(Windows2000服務(wù)器版)作為網(wǎng)絡(luò)服務(wù)器操作系統(tǒng)平臺(tái),它具有穩(wěn)定性、可靠性、安全性和可擴(kuò)充性等優(yōu)點(diǎn),是一種同時(shí)具有改進(jìn)性和創(chuàng)新性的產(chǎn)品。無紙化考試系統(tǒng)應(yīng)用環(huán)境的整體結(jié)構(gòu),基于C/S結(jié)構(gòu)構(gòu)建,在局域網(wǎng)內(nèi)通過客戶端器就能登錄考試。這種增長(zhǎng)非常迅速,不僅表現(xiàn)在支持的用戶數(shù)量上,而且表現(xiàn)在提供的用戶服務(wù)的復(fù)雜性和集成性方面。可擴(kuò)展性是指系統(tǒng)能保證可持續(xù)增長(zhǎng)以滿足用戶的需求和業(yè)務(wù)復(fù)雜性要求。對(duì)于網(wǎng)上考試系統(tǒng)來說,題庫、試卷、成績(jī)?nèi)叩陌踩允潜匦枰右钥紤]的。安全性是通過為信息的機(jī)密性、完整性和可靠性提
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1